
An exquisite variegated English lavender with fragrant lavender-blue flowers on tall, thin, strong, upright stems above a dense, compact mound of narrow, gray-green leaves with cream-colored margins. A wonderful addition to a sunny border, rock garden, or herb garden. An excellent lavender for cutting and drying.
Type: Herbaceous perennial
Family: Lamiaceae
Zone: 5 to 8
Height: 1.00 to 1.50 feet
Spread: 1.00 to 1.50 feet
Bloom Time: June to August
Sun: Full sun
Water: Dry to medium
Maintenance: Medium
Flower: Showy, Fragrant, Good Cut, Good Dried
Leaf: Colorful, Fragrant
Attracts: Butterflies
Tolerate: Rabbit, Deer, Drought, Dry Soil, Shallow-Rocky Soil, Air Pollution
